Silicon Labs (NASDAQ: SLAB) is the leading innovator in low-power wireless connectivity, building embedded technology that connects devices and improves lives. Merging cutting-edge technology into the world’s most highly integrated SoCs, Silicon Labs provides device makers the solutions, support, and ecosystems needed to create advanced edge connectivity applications. Headquartered in Austin, Texas, Silicon Labs has operations in over 16 countries and is the trusted partner for innovative solutions in the smart home, industrial IoT, and smart cities markets. What we’re looking for:

Responsible for developing and executing plans that ensure a smooth transition from product development to full-scale production. This role collaborates cross-functionally with engineering, demand planning, manufacturing, and quality teams to ensure materials, schedules, and resources are aligned to the complete production cycle.

Skills you’ll need:

  • Develop and manage end-to-end project plans for new product introductions.

  • Coordinate production plan to support prototype, pilot, and initial production builds.

  • Collaborate with engineering teams to understand product requirements and timelines.

  • Identify potential supply chain risks and develop mitigation strategies.

  • Ensure timely availability of components for new product builds.

  • Monitor progress of NPI milestones and escalate issues to stakeholders.

  • Maintain accurate records of part numbers, BOMs (Bill of Materials), and planning parameters in ERP systems.

  • Support change management processes for product revisions and updates.

  • Interact with internal and some external contacts.

  • Other duties as required.

Qualifications & Requirements:

  • Minimum bachelor’s degree in Supply Chain, Engineering, or a related field

  • 5+ years of experience in supply chain planning, production planning, or NPI

  • Excellent organizational, communication, and problem-solving skills

  • Ability to work in a fast-paced, cross-functional environment

  • Proficient in Microsoft Excel, Word & Power Point

  • Strong knowledge of ERP/MRP systems (e.g., SAP)

What you need to know about the Singapore Tech Scene

The digital revolution has driven a constant demand for tech professionals across industries like software development, data analytics and cybersecurity. In Singapore, one of the largest cities in Southeast Asia, the demand for tech talent is so high that the government continues to invest millions into programs designed to develop a talent pipeline directly from universities while also scaling efforts in pre-employment training and mid-career upskilling to expand and elevate its workforce.
